The Timby Awards – Northwood's Student-Athlete Awards Night - took place on WEDNESDAY, APRIL 29 2015. The event was held in the Bennett Center at 8:00 p.m.
This event was our way of celebrating the 2014-15 athletic year by recognizing all our seniors, as well as presenting several other awards such as:

Moment of the Year
- Baseball earns a sweep over Hillsdale after trailing 4-1 in the final game and winning with a walk-off single in the bottom of the 9th
- Men's Basketball with a 73-66 OT win over No. 17 LSSU to earn a spot into the GLIAC Tournament after which the crowd stormed the court
- Women's Basketball with a 96-90 OT win over No. 8 MTU after trailing by 8 with less than :50 left and buzzer beater to force OT
-
Football raises Head Coach Pat Riepma's chair after earning a 23-13 win at Northern Mich. to open the season **WINNER**
- Men's Soccer earns 1-0 win over SVSU in GLIAC Tournament Championship
- Softball earns sweep over Grand Valley including a 9-inning 7-6 win before hitting a grand slam in the 5th of game two to win 5-4
- Men's Tennis earns a 5-4 win over Grand Valley in GLIAC Tournament after trailing 3-0 through doubles
